
Shadow bands reframe eclipse mystery with new data
CNN reports on shadow bands—the faint light-and-dark ripples around total solar eclipses—where scientists testing its cause found in 2017 that a 4.5 Hz signal appeared both on the ground and at high altitude, suggesting diffraction-interference may play a role alongside turbulence. The 2024 eclipse, despite more sensitive sensors, didn’t reveal shadow bands due to cloud cover, and aircraft data likewise failed to reproduce the signal, leaving the mechanism unresolved. With a future eclipse approaching, researchers and citizen scientists plan new measurements from Spain and elsewhere, using simple observation setups to help settle the question.
